Make RuleBuilder methods take Paths
There are no more Make paths being used in Soong now that dexpreopting and hiddenapi are in Soong. Use the Path types in the inputs to RuleBuilder, and fix all users of RuleBuilder. This reapplies I886f803d9a3419a43b2cae412537645f94c5dfbf with fixes to disable preopt for Soong-only builds when the global dexpreopt.config doesn't exist.
